Brand New Warehouse Opening - A Fantastic Opportunity for a Fresh Start!
Omnia Resourcing is recruiting on behalf of our client for a Warehouse Maintenance Operative to join a brand-new warehouse operation in Rugby. This is an exciting opportunity to be part of a new site from the very beginning, helping to establish and maintain a safe, efficient, and fully operational warehouse environment. If you are looking for a fresh challenge, this could be the perfect opportunity for you.
Key Responsibilities:
- Carry out general maintenance and repairs across the warehouse and site.
- Complete routine inspections of equipment, facilities, and building areas.
- Respond promptly to maintenance requests and site issues.
- Support planned preventative maintenance activities.
- Ensure all maintenance work is completed safely and in line with health and safety procedures.
- Maintain a clean, safe, and well-organised working environment.
- Support the successful launch and ongoing operation of the new warehouse.
About You:
- Previous experience in a maintenance role within a warehouse, industrial, manufacturing, or facilities environment.
- Strong practical skills in general maintenance and repairs.
- A proactive approach with good problem-solving skills.
- Able to work independently and manage priorities effectively.
- Flexible attitude to meet the needs of the business.
- Strong commitment to health and safety standards.
